首页 百科 正文

华为编程语言报名

百科 编辑:婧仪 日期:2024-05-03 08:23:12 542人浏览

探寻华为编程语言:鸿蒙HarmonyOS

华为的编程语言鸿蒙HarmonyOS近年来备受关注,它是一种基于微内核的分布式操作系统。鸿蒙HarmonyOS的编程语言主要有两种:C语言和Java语言。这两种语言分别用于不同层次的开发。

1. C语言

C语言在鸿蒙HarmonyOS的底层开发中起着重要作用。它被用于编写系统核心部分,包括驱动程序和底层服务。这些部分需要高效、精确地控制硬件资源,而C语言正是因为其高效性和直接性而被选用。C语言还可以很好地与汇编语言配合使用,进一步优化底层代码的性能。

对于想要深入了解和参与鸿蒙HarmonyOS底层开发的开发者,熟练掌握C语言是必不可少的。华为提供了丰富的文档和开发工具,帮助开发者快速上手,并在底层开发中发挥自己的技术优势。

2. Java语言

Java语言则主要用于鸿蒙HarmonyOS的应用层开发。作为一种跨平台的编程语言,Java语言能够轻松地实现应用程序的移植和扩展,这与鸿蒙HarmonyOS分布式架构的理念相契合。

开发者可以使用Java语言编写各种应用程序,包括手机应用、智能穿戴、智能家居等。华为提供了丰富的开发工具和框架,如鸿蒙应用框架(Harmony Application Framework),帮助开发者快速构建功能丰富、稳定可靠的应用程序。

华为编程语言报名

指导建议

如果你对系统底层开发感兴趣,想要深入了解操作系统的原理和实现细节,那么建议你学习C语言,并尝试参与鸿蒙HarmonyOS的底层开发项目。

如果你对应用程序开发更感兴趣,想要开发各种类型的应用,那么建议你学习Java语言,并利用华为提供的开发工具和框架,开发基于鸿蒙HarmonyOS的应用程序。

无论你选择哪种语言和开发方向,都可以在华为的开发平台上找到丰富的资源和支持,实现自己的技术和创意。

分享到

文章已关闭评论!